How much does it cost to rent an apartment in New Territory?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| New Territory Studio Apartments | $1,257 | $1,139 | $1,304 |
| New Territory 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,397 | $1,028 | $2,537 |
| New Territory 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,783 | $1,268 | $5,515 |
| New Territory 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,110 | $1,522 | $5,800 |
| New Territory 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,850 | $2,850 | $2,850 |

Frequently Asked Questions about New Territory
What is the current price range for One Bedroom New Territory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in New Territory ranges from $1,028 to $2,537 with an average monthly rent of $1,397.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in New Territory c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in New Territory range from $1,268 to $5,515.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,783.
How expensive are New Territory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 11 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in New Territory on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,522 to $5,800 - averaging $2,110 for the location.
